## Deployment

The Gleanscope GPU profiler deploys as a daemonset alongside the inference fleet. Each node runs one agent that samples allocation events and ships them to the central collector. Verify the collector endpoint is reachable before rollout, and confirm the agent starts with the following configuration values.

settings of fafog-haduf:
ZORIX_PIN=4648
ZORIX_METRICS_HOST=metrics.zorix.paliqsys.corp
ZORIX_LOG_LEVEL=info
ZORIX_TENANT=druix

14:22 — The incremental rebuild pipeline for the Marrowgate docs site began skipping changed pages. New folks: our static site, Quillstone, only rebuilds pages whose content hash changed, and the hash index lives in a shared cache. A truncated cache write at 14:19 left the index claiming every page was fresh, so edits published between 14:19 and 14:40 never appeared. Rolling the cache back restored correct rebuilds by 14:47. The rebuild that confirmed recovery is identified by the token below.

session token of kageg-tahop = htk14_af3c1ccccb7dcf

Prod and staging diverged again. The Brindlehurst site's lockers accept the fallback PIN flow; every other site requires app-based unlock. Root cause: someone hand-edited the Brindlehurst node during the March outage and never backported. New folks: do not edit locker nodes directly. All changes go through the Lattimer deploy pipeline, which stamps a drift hash. Pending fix: re-baseline Brindlehurst against the canonical template this sprint. For reference, the canonical access-flow configuration is below.

config for tagep-yajef:
ulawyn:
  log_level: error
  metrics_host: metrics.ulawyn.lumiclabs.internal
  pin: 0564
  pool_size: 32

// MAX_CRASH_BATCH controls how many crash reports the Pebbletrail
// mobile client uploads per flush to the Sorrel ingest tier. Raising it
// past 50 has historically overwhelmed the symbolication queue during
// regional outages, so change it only with capacity sign-off. If ingest
// lag alerts fire, check the dashboard for the active client build
// before paging the pipeline team. The token below identifies it.

pipeline stamp: htk31_f769b577b3028a4e9958e5bb8d1259a